We love go serve ours with fresh butter, an assortment of jams and whipped cream on top.


Ingredients (serves 12 | makes 12 Scones (depending on size cut out))

  • 3 cups Self raising flour
  • 1 cup Lemonade
  • 1 cup Cream

Method

  1. Pre-heat the oven to 220C. The oven needs to be pre-heated fully before starting to bake your scones. During this step, please also line a baking tray with baking paper.
  2. Put the flour in a medium bowl. Mix together the lemonade and cream, then pour it into the flour.
  3. With a dinner knife stir together just until the flour is mostly mixed in.
  4. Turn out onto a floured work surface. The dough may still be a little wet and sticky, thats ok. With floured hands, knead it gently a few times.
  5. Now it's time to roll out and cut your shapes out with a circle cookie cutter (or your desired shape). Once on lined baking tray, use some leftover cream and brush the tops of scones with the cream
  6. Bake the scones for around 12 to 15 minutes until they have risen and the tops are golden brown
  7. Once cooled down, serve with toppings of your choice and enjoy!!
